HANOI, Viet Nam, May 15, 2024 – At the head office of the State Capital Investment Corporation (SCIC), Deputy General Director Le Thanh Tuan and representatives of SCIC's functional departments received and worked with a delegation from IMD Business School led by Dr. Misiek Piskorski, Dean of IMD Asia and Oceania.

During the working session, Dr. Misiek Piskorski introduced IMD Business School, which is one of the world's top-ranked schools for MBA and other business education programs, as evidenced by assessments and rankings from prestigious research organizations and journals such as: Ranked 1st among the top 6 flexible training programs worldwide for 24 years by the Financial Times; Ranked first among international 1-year MBA programs by Forbes in 2019, 2017, 2013, 2011, 2007 and 2001; Won 8 Gold awards for creative learning experiences at the 2023 Brandon Hall Technology Awards; Ranked in the top 5 globally according to The Case Center Impact Index 2023, which assesses the research impact of business case studies; and IMD was also the most published organization after Harvard and MIT in the Harvard Business Review and Sloan Management Review from 2019-2023.

Delegation of IMD Asia-Oceania

According to Dr. Misiek Piskorski, the IMD Asia-Oceania branch is also expanding in scale and scope, with a presence in many countries such as Japan, Thailand, Malaysia, Singapore and Indonesia. Recently, IMD Asia-Oceania marked its presence in Viet Nam by supporting digital transformation training for Techcombank's executives. For government agencies and state-owned enterprise management organizations, IMD Asia-Oceania offers many training activities to strengthen organizational structure and leadership at state-owned enterprises, enabling them to overcome current challenges and serve strategic, sustainable purposes. Indonesia is a country where IMD Asia-Oceania has had the opportunity to cooperate and work in-depth with the Indonesian Ministry of State-Owned Enterprises to improve the capacity and competitiveness of Indonesian government agencies.

With its current trajectory, IMD Asia-Oceania sees Vietnam as a country with great growth potential. Therefore, IMD Asia-Oceania wishes to further enhance contact and exchange with SCIC to promote cooperation opportunities in line with the training criteria of both sides.

On SCIC's side, Mr. Le Thanh Tuan welcomed the interest and goodwill for cooperation from the IMD Asia-Oceania delegation. Mr. Le Thanh Tuan also affirmed that in the process of restructuring and improving the efficiency of state-owned enterprises as well as effectively implementing SCIC's Development Strategy, the coordination of leading corporate training organizations like IMD will be highly necessary. At the same time, he also shared more information with the delegation about the scale of operations of some large, high-potential Vietnamese enterprises under SCIC's management such as Vinamilk and Sabeco. Through this, Mr. Tuan expressed his desire that after this meeting, the two sides will further enhance contact to exchange information to develop optimized, suitable training programs, as well as open IMD courses for SCIC leaders and affiliated enterprises. Mr. Le Thanh Tuan also affirmed that SCIC is ready to act as a bridge to support and create the most favorable conditions for the two sides to cooperate in the long term.
